Jacobs 2 TDs in the first half. Carr played well. Couple nice deep throws today. 2nd half, defense stepped up and forced a punt twice. Gruden went conservative, 3 and out both times. Lion eventually score picking on who else Whitehead to tie it. 

Gruden goes to Richard 4 or 5 times straight to get into 3rd and goal. Carr escapes, buys times finds 3rd and Refro who taps the toes for a deciding TD.

Lions 2 mins, drive to the 1 with no time outs. 8 seconds to go... Raider gift them a time out. 4th and goal Ferrell pressures, Stafford goes to Thomas and KJ breaks it up for the win.

Exciting game. Team win all around.
